
Telecoms shouldn’t track customer habits for marketing: PIAC
News | January 27, 2014
To permit BCE Inc. to collect customers’ personal information and track their activities for marketing and advertising purposes “allows Bell to change the nature of what a telecom-service provider is paid to do,” said a lawyer who’s filed an application with the CRTC challenging this practice.
